Fear,

Nothing stops people from living the life of their dreams more than fear.

People have all sorts of irrational fears. But we are only born with two: The fear of falling and the fear of loud noise. Every other fear is learned.

In this episode we will explore one of those basic fears, the fear of falling.

Watch and listen to 5 people who have never been skydiving before and follow them thru the process of jumping “tandem style” from a perfectly good airplane at over 12,000 feet in the air!
